随着互联网的发展,我们进入了一个全新的时代——Web3。Web3不仅是当前技术进步的一部分,更是未来网络的架构基础。Web3代表了去中心化的互联网,利用区块链技术实现数据和应用的分散管理,使用户能够拥有更多的控制权。那么,Web3技术栈是如何构建的?它有哪些主要组成部分?本文将深入探讨Web3的技术栈,分析其构成要素,并展望其在未来的应用前景。
在深入Web3技术栈之前,我们需要首先了解Web3的基本概念。传统互联网(Web2)以中心化的方式为主,用户数据存储在大型公司的服务器上,且控制权完全掌握在这些中心化公司手中。这意味着用户的数据隐私和控制权受到制约。
Web3则通过区块链和去中心化技术,致力于重建数据的所有权和用户的隐私。用户不仅可以在网络上自由交流和交易,还可以通过智能合约实现去中心化的应用(DApps)。这种新模式将带来更高的透明度和安全性,同时也为创新提供了更广阔的空间。
Web3技术栈的构成可以分为多个层次,每一层都有其独特的技术和功能:
区块链是Web3的核心基础,其通过去中心化的方式在网络上记录数据,确保数据的不可篡改和透明性。以太坊(Ethereum)是目前最广泛使用的区块链之一,它为开发者提供了创建去中心化应用的能力。这一层不仅支持数字货币的交易,还可以实现智能合约,自动化执行合约条款。
在区块链之上,有多种网络协议和标准,允许不同的区块链进行互操作。这层技术的目标是实现各链之间的信息共享与交易,使得Web3的生态更加丰富。例如,IPFS(InterPlanetary File System)是一种用于分布式文件存储的协议,使得文件存储不再依赖中心化的服务器。
DApps是Web3的应用层,这是基于区块链和协议所构建的去中心化应用。DApps能够增强用户对数据的控制,并提供更自信的交易和交互环境。举例而言,去中心化金融(DeFi)应用如Uniswap和Aave,允许用户在没有中介的情况下进行借贷和交易。
在Web3世界中,用户的身份和资产通过数字钱包来管理。这些钱包不仅存储加密货币,还能够进行去中心化身份认证。用户通过私钥持有资产和身份信息,确保了隐私和安全性。MetaMask和Ledger是当前流行的数字钱包,用户可以利用这些工具与各类DApps进行交互。
Web3技术带来了诸多优势,但同时也面临一些挑战。理解这些优势和挑战,可以帮助我们更好地把握Web3的未来发展。
首先,Web3提供了更高的安全性。从根本上讲,去中心化意味着没有单一的攻击点,黑客攻击某个节点的可能性较小。其次,Web3确保了用户的数据隐私和控制权。每个用户对其数据和数字身份拥有完全的控制权,能够自由选择何时、何地以及如何共享其个人信息。此外,Web3还具有开放性,任何人都可以基于现有的协议和技术构建新应用,从而促进创新。
然而,Web3也有其挑战。技术的复杂性可能会阻碍普通用户的接受度,学习如何使用相关工具和应用需要时间。同时,Web3的生态系统目前还不够成熟,部分技术和标准尚未得到广泛认可,导致不同链和平台之间的互操作性较差。此外,政策和法律合规性问题仍然是Web3发展过程中的一个重要难题,各国和地区对区块链技术和数字资产的监管政策尚未统一。
尽管面临挑战,Web3的未来充满了可能性。随着技术的不断进步和创新,许多预测表明,Web3将逐渐得到更广泛的应用。预测中,有几个领域表现尤为活跃:
DeFi是Web3中最引人注目的应用之一,或将重新定义金融的本质。用户可以在去中心化的平台上自由进行借贷、交易、储蓄等金融活动,削弱传统金融机构的垄断地位。随着更多用户认识到DeFi的便利性和透明性,预计这一市场将继续迅猛增长。
在数字身份方面,Web3也将发挥重要作用。用户将能够通过区块链技术创建去中心化的身份认证系统,减少虚假身份和数据泄露风险。例如,使用去中心化身份协议(DID),用户可以在多个平台中安全地验证自己的身份,从而保证其私隐。
Web3还将改变内容创作和分发的方式。创作者可以直接与读者或听众互动,去掉中介角色,从而获得更多的收益。同时,用户也可以通过区块链奖励机制来支持他们喜欢的创作者。这种模式将有望促进更多的优质内容创作。
Web3与传统互联网(Web2)之间存在显著区别。Web2是中心化架构,所有用户数据和信息都储存在大型公司的服务器上,这些公司控制着用户的数据和隐私。而在Web3中,用户的数据和身份通过区块链技术得以去中心化管理。用户拥有对自身数据的完全控制权,能够自由选择如何分享或使用其个人信息。此外,Web3中的智能合约允许无须中介的交易和协议执行,这一特点使得Web3在操作上的灵活性和透明度远超传统互联网。
另外,Web3推动开放性和自治原则,任何人都可以使用或创建协议与应用程序,而不用依赖大型企业或特定的政府机构。用户在Web3中的权力得到了增强,使得他们能以更自信的方式参与到互联网活动中。
智能合约是一种运行在区块链上的自执行程序,它的代码和协议被存储在区块链中,并可在特定条件被触发时自动执行。智能合约的基本原理是根据预设的条款执行交易和协议,确保在没有中介的情况下完成所有事务。这一机制既提高了交易的效率,也降低了成本。
智能合约通常是一种“如果-那么”的逻辑结构,例如:“如果用户支付了某笔费用,那么系统就会释放某项服务”。这种透明和自动化的流程不仅增加了信任度,还减少了人为操作的风险。此外,智能合约还可以用于各种应用场景,如去中心化金融(DeFi)交易、商品追踪、链上投票等,未来的应用潜力巨大。
Web3的一个核心优势是能够显著提升用户的隐私和数据保护能力。在Web3生态中,用户的数据控制权掌握在自己手中,传统的平台不再能够随意获取用户的数据。这能够防止数据滥用和隐私泄露,用户可以选择共享何种信息并且在使用后进行撤回。
例如,在Web3中,每个用户可以通过去中心化身份(DID)管理自己的身份信息,用户可以选择在不同平台间使用不同的“身份”,以最大程度保护个人隐私。同时,数据的加密存储与区块链技术结合确保用户数据即使在存储时也不会被篡改,这使得Web3在数据安全和隐私保护上的潜力远超Web2。
为提高用户的参与度和应用的使用体验,Web3开发者需要在几方面改进。首先,简化用户体验是至关重要的。尽管Web3的技术高度复杂,但为用户提供直观、友好的界面,降低进入门槛,可以使更多用户愿意尝试这些新应用。用户需要有明确的使用指导,理解如何操作DApps、如何管理他们的数字货币及身份。
其次,可以引入激励机制,鼓励用户参与平台活动。例如,通过“流动性挖矿”或“空投”等活动,让用户在参与的过程中获得奖励,这可以提升用户黏性,促进更多的社区参与。同时,社交功能的整合也非常重要,用户在Web3中可以借助社交平台分享各自的经验,增强相应应用的活跃度。
尽管Web3在技术上提供了去中心化和透明性的优势,但在全球范围内的监管问题仍然是一个挑战。不同国家和地区对于区块链、数字货币及去中心化应用的法律法规尚未达成一致,导致了合规性和法律风险的增加。许多国家对加密资产的定义和监管方式各不相同,有的国家可能选择审慎监管,有的则采取较为宽松的政策,造成市场的不确定性。
此外,Web3的匿名性使得追溯用户身份更为困难,这可能导致不法分子利用这些技术进行洗钱、逃税等非法活动。因此,如何在保护用户隐私的同时,确保合规性和法治监管,是Web3未来发展过程中亟需解决的问题。各国监管机构需要就Web3相关的政策进行合作,以创建一个更加安全且充满创新的全球生态环境。
总结而言,Web3作为互联网的未来,其技术栈的组成与发展趋势将深刻影响我们数字生活的方方面面。虽然在技术和监管上仍需克服许多挑战,但其对数据隐私和用户控制权的强调,将为我们带来更加开放和安全的网络体验。